Diphtheria Acute infectious disease characterised by liberation of an exotoxin resulting in: • Formation of greyish / yellowish membrane (“false membrane”) over tonsils, pharynx, or larynx, with well-defined edges. Dr.Harivansh Chopra
Diphtheria • Congestion, Oedema, or Local Tissue Destruction. • Regional lymphadenopathy (Bullneck). • Toxemia. Child with bullneck diphtheria Dr.Harivansh Chopra
Problem Statement – World • Rare disease in most developed countries owing to vaccination. • Global burden in 2002: • 185,000 DALYs. • 5000 deaths. Dr.Harivansh Chopra

Diphtheria – Agent Factor • .Corynebacterium diphtheriae. • Gram positive, Non-motile. Dr.Harivansh Chopra
Diphtheria – Agent Factor • .Types – • Gravis. • Mitis. Dr.Harivansh Chopra
Diphtheria – Agent Factor • .Types – • Intermedius. • May be – • Toxigenic. • Non-toxigenic – bacteriophage can convert them into toxigenic. C. diptheriae intermedius Dr.Harivansh Chopra
Diphtheria – Host Factors • Source of infection – • Cases. • Carriers – 95 carriers for 5 cases: • Types – Temporary & Chronic. • May be nasal or throat. • Incidence is 0.1 – 5.0%. Dr.Harivansh Chopra
Diphtheria – Infective Material • Nasopharyngeal secretions. • Discharge from skin lesions. • Fomites – • Throat spatulas. • Utensils. • Toys. • Pencils. Dr.Harivansh Chopra
Period of Infectivity • 14 – 28 days unless treated. • Carriers may remain infective for much longer period. Dr.Harivansh Chopra
Diphtheria – Portal of entry Respiratory Route Non-Respiratory Route Dr.Harivansh Chopra
Mode of Transmission • Droplet infection. • Droplet nuclei. • Through infected cutaneous lesions. • Through – • Milk. • Foods. • Fomites. Dr.Harivansh Chopra
Incubation Period 2 – 6 days. Dr.Harivansh Chopra
Diphtheria – Environmental Factors Transmission favoured in winter season. Dr.Harivansh Chopra
Diphtheria – Clinical Features Anterior Nasal: More common in Infants. • Rhinorrhoea – Discharge may be: • Watery. • Serosanguinous. • Purulent. • Foul-smelling. Dr.Harivansh Chopra
Diphtheria – Clinical Features Anterior Nasal: • White membrane. • Delayed systemic manifestations. Dr.Harivansh Chopra
Diphtheria – Clinical Features Pharyngeal/Tonsillar : • Symptoms: • Sore throat. • 50% have fever. • Few have dysphagia, hoarseness, malaise, or headache. Dr.Harivansh Chopra
Diphtheria – Clinical Features Pharyngeal/Tonsillar : • Signs: • Unilateral or bilateral tonsillar membrane formation, which extends to cover uvula, soft palate, posterior oropharynx, hypopharynx, and glottis. Dr.Harivansh Chopra
Diphtheria – Clinical Features Pharyngeal/Tonsillar : • Signs: • Soft tissue oedema. • Enlarged lymph nodes, resulting in bull-neck appearance. • Effort to remove membrane results in haemorrhage. Dr.Harivansh Chopra
Diphtheria – Clinical Features Laryngeal: • Noisy breathing. • Stridor. • Hoarseness of voice. • Dry cough. • Fever. • May lead to asphyxia. Dr.Harivansh Chopra
Diphtheria – Clinical Features Cutaneous: • Ulcers around mouth and nose. • Ulcers: • Defined border. • Membranous base. Dr.Harivansh Chopra
Diphtheria – Clinical Features Conjunctival: • Affects palpebral conjunctiva. • Presentation: • Oedematous. • Membrane formation. Dr.Harivansh Chopra
Diphtheria – Clinical Features Aural: • Otitis externa. • Discharge: • Persistant. • Purulent. • Foul-smelling. Dr.Harivansh Chopra
Diphtheria – Diagnosis • Specimen: Nasal and throat swab, or any other muco-cutaneous lesion. • Portion of membrane, and underlying exudate submitted. • Laboratory notified to use selective media. Dr.Harivansh Chopra
Diagnosis • Early diagnosis is important. • Diagnosis based on high suspicion in a child with: • Sore throat. • Dyspnea. • Noisy breathing. • Fever. Dr.Harivansh Chopra

Treatment • Start treatment at earliest on clinical suspicion. • Don’t wait for the laboratory report. Dr.Harivansh Chopra
Treatment – Principles Antitoxins – Neutralising circulating Toxins. Antibiotics – Eradicate Bacteria. Supportive Treatment. Manage Complications. Dr.Harivansh Chopra
Passive Immunisation – Immunoglobulins • ADS of horse origin. • ADS of human origin. Dr.Harivansh Chopra

Antitoxin Treatment – human • Dose: 0.6 ml/kg body weight Intramuscular (Available as 2ml vial with 300 mg Globulins). • Advantage over ADS (horse origin): • Hypersensitivity absent. • Longer protection. Dr.Harivansh Chopra
Treatment • Antibiotics: • No substitute to anti-toxin. • Stops production of more toxin. • Dosage: • Erythromycin: 40-50mg/kg/24 hrs. divided 6 hourly orally QID X 14 days. Dr.Harivansh Chopra
Treatment • Dosage: • Crystalline Penicillin G: 100,000 – 150,000 IU/kg/24 hrs in 4 – 6 divided doses I.V./I.M. X 14 days. OR • Procaine Penicillin: 25,000 – 50,000 IU/kg/24 hrs in 2 divided doses IM X 14 days. Dr.Harivansh Chopra
Diphtheria Complication – Asphyxia Obstruction of respiratory passage by membrane: • Tachypnea. • Stridor. • Use of accessory muscles of respiration. • Cyanosis. Dr.Harivansh Chopra
Treatment of Asphyxia • Tracheostomy. • Humidified air. Dr.Harivansh Chopra
Diphtheria Complication – Myocarditis • In acute phase. • Toxic cardiomyopathy occurs in approx 10-25% patients and is responsible for 50-60% of deaths. • Usually in 2nd – 3rd week of illness. Dr.Harivansh Chopra
Treatment of Myocarditis • Bed rest, Avoid exertion. • Restrict fluid and salt intake. • Diuretics. • May need sedation and oxygen. • Digoxin in decompensated heart. Dr.Harivansh Chopra
Diphtheria Complication – Neurological involvement • Parallel the onset of primary infection. • Multiphasic in onset: Dr.Harivansh Chopra
Diphtheria Complication – Neurological involvement • Palatal and Pharyngeal paralysis: • Swallowing difficulty. • Nasal voice. • Regurgitation through nose. Dr.Harivansh Chopra
Diphtheria Complication – Neurological involvement Peripheral Neuropathy: • Occurs 1 – 3 months after. • Paraesthesia. • Resolves completely. Dr.Harivansh Chopra
Treatment of Neurological complications • Nasogastric feeding. • Treatment of general weakness. Dr.Harivansh Chopra
Case fatality rate • With Treatment – <5% (Unchanged for the past 50 years). • Without treatment – 10%. Dr.Harivansh Chopra
